Coils keep going bad

2001 Camaro with the V6. I have replaced 4 coils in the last 3 months and they seem to be radom as which one goes out.What could be the culprit of this?

try getting your money back and/or try different brands. check your grounds, and check your ignition control module. If you can find a cheap control module in the salvage yard, try swapping that out first. When the coils go bad, have you tried just swapping it with another one on the car to see if the problem follows the coil, or if it stays in the same position? If you cant track it down, try finding cheap salvage yard parts to test it before spending $$$$ on new parts. You can always buy a new one after you find the problem and then you'll have a cheap spare.
